While much of the attention around Alberta premier Danielle Smith’s proposed October 19 referendum has been on the possibility of separation from Canada, parts of the referendum package focus directly on immigration and newcomer access to public services—issues that get to the heart of the debate. According to the Government of Alberta’s referendum materials, the proposals include five questions aimed at expanding Alberta’s control over immigration, restricting access to some provincially funded services based on immigration status, and redefining eligibility for certain provincial...
